Utilities and hidden costs can often eat into your budget, so always clarify what is included in the rent. In the RSA, electricity is often paid via a prepaid meter, which gives you more control over your spending. However, things like water, refuse collection, and sewerage are often billed separately. Before signing anything for your аренда жилья, ask to see a recent municipal bill so you know exactly what the "extra" costs look like. Some modern apartments include high-speed fiber internet in the price, which can save you a significant amount each month since data costs in South Africa can be relatively high compared to other countries.

Townhouses and "clusters" are another staple of South African housing. A townhouse is usually part of a complex of similar units that share common walls and a communal entrance. A cluster house is similar but is usually detached and located within a secure, gated perimeter. These are incredibly popular for families because they offer a "lock-up-and-go" lifestyle. You get the benefits of a private home and a small garden, but with the added peace of mind that comes from living in a community with shared security costs. This is a very common choice for long-term аренда жилья for people with children.

When you sign a lease for an apartment, you’ll usually be asked for a deposit and the first month’s rent. Most landlords also require a credit check and proof of income. If you are an expat, you might need to show your work permit and a bank statement from your home country. It’s also common for the tenant to pay a "lease fee" to the agency for drawing up the paperwork. This is a one-time cost, but it's something to budget for when planning your аренда проживания. Make sure you do a thorough "snag list" when you move in, documenting every scratch and dent so you don't lose your deposit when you leave.

Long-term аренда жилья in the RSA usually involves a lease agreement of 12 months, although 6-month or 2-year leases are also possible. This is the most stable and cost-effective way to live in the country. When you sign a long-term lease, you are protected by the Rental Housing Act, which outlines the rights and responsibilities of both the tenant and the landlord. This includes rules about rent increases, maintenance, and how your deposit should be handled. It’s a very formal process that provides a high level of security for your аренда проживания.
To secure a long-term аренда жилья, you will typically need to provide a fair amount of documentation. This is often referred to as "FICA" documentation and includes your ID or passport, proof of income (like three months of bank statements or a salary slip), and a credit report. If you are new to the country and don't have a local credit history, you might find it more difficult. In these cases, offering a larger deposit or having a local person act as a guarantor can help convince a landlord to take you on. It’s all about building trust and proving that you can afford the monthly аренда проживания.

When looking for long-term аренда проживания, it’s vital to use reputable agencies or to vet private landlords very carefully. Never pay a deposit before you have physically seen the property and signed a lease. Scams are unfortunately common, so if a deal looks too good to be true, it probably is. Always check that the landlord or agent is registered with the Property Practitioners Regulatory Authority (PPRA). This gives you an extra layer of protection if something goes wrong during your аренда жилья period.
